About
SNCF, France's national state-owned rail company, also plays a role in bus transportation, often referred to as "Autocar" in Europe. While primarily known for its extensive train network, SNCF Connect, their digital platform, partners with bus companies like FlixBus and BlaBlaCar Bus to offer affordable bus tickets for both domestic and international routes. Additionally, SNCF's regional TER services include both trains and coaches, providing daily travel options across France. The SNCF Group, through its subsidiary Keolis, operates various modes of transport worldwide, including trams, buses, and metros.

About
BlaBlaCar Bus (formerly known as Ouibus or iDBUS) is a long-distance coach company operating in 10 European countries and connecting over 300 destinations. A subsidiary of the French carpooling company BlaBlaCar, it offers comfortable travel with standard amenities such as air conditioning, toilets, USB and power outlets for charging devices, extra legroom, and adjustable seats. Free Wi-Fi is available on select routes. BlaBlaCar Bus offers only a Standard ticket type, which allows passengers to bring one carry-on bag and up to two checked bags per person.

France uses the euro (EUR) as its currency. Travelers generally find it convenient to use cards for most transactions, especially in cities and larger establishments, but carrying some cash is advisable for small vendors, markets, and rural areas where card acceptance may be limited.
In Paris,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like metro stations, tourist attractions, and popular shopping streets. Common scams include distraction techniques, such as people asking for signatures on petitions or offering friendship bracelets, which can lead to theft. It's also advisable to be wary of unofficial taxi drivers and avoid unlicensed cabs to prevent overcharging. Staying alert in busy places and safeguarding personal belongings helps ensure a safer visit.
